Type | Parameter |
Memory Type | Non-Volatile |
Memory Format | EPROM |
Technology | EPROM - OTP |
Memory Size | 256Kbit |
Memory Organization | 32K x 8 |
Memory Interface | Parallel |
Access Time | 70 ns |
Voltage - Supply | 4.5V ~ 5.5V |
Operating Temperature | -40°C ~ 85°C (TC) |
Mounting Type | Through Hole |
Package / Case | 28-DIP (0.600", 15.24mm) |
Supplier Device Package | 28-PDIP |
Base Product Number | AT27C256 |
The AT27C256R-70PU is widely used in electronic systems that require stable firmware and program storage. Engineers often apply this EPROM memory in industrial controllers, embedded development platforms, testing equipment, communication devices, and legacy electronic products. It is also suitable for applications that require programmable memory during development cycles, including prototype systems and customized hardware designs.
